Follow These Steps To Inspect Downspouts

While completing regular gutter repairs and inspection is essential to every home, it is just as important to inspect downspouts. These features are an extension of your gutters. By keeping them clear and damage-free, you are keeping water from collecting and leaking into your home. Water damage repair costs an average of $2,386 to fix, jumping to $2,688 when standing water is involved. While this is less than wind damage ($5,757-10,000) and fire damage ($4,172), it is still a blow to your repair budget. Fortunately, you can avoid high costs by following these simple inspection tips.

Look For Leaks

Due to general wear and tear, leaks are a common with downspouts. They can happen because of surface cracks, missing bolts, or loosening seams. Look for dripping water or puddles on the ground. These are signs that you should order gutter installation or repairs.

Check For Signs Of Clogs

Just as leaves and other debris can accumulate in your gutters, they can also get trapped in your downspouts. If you are noticing water backing up in your gutters or rainwater overflowing, blocked spouts may be the problem. Either take steps to carefully clear these out yourself or hire a professional to do so.

Inspect Downspouts for Structural Damage

Check the surface of every spout of cracks, dents, and other issues. Even if they aren’t causing problems at the moment, they could become worse and eventually cause leaks and overflows. Have a professional assess the damage to determine whether full replacement will be necessary.

Spot Rusty Spots

Rusting is almost inevitable with home exterior products, as the seasons and water damage can cause corrosion. It can become problematic when there is too much rust, as it can put your home at risk for structural damage. Rust damage may warrant full replacement.

If you notice any major problems while inspecting your downspouts, be sure to check if these issues are mirrored in your gutters and roof. A professional home exterior company will be able to to provide gutter cleaning maintenance programs, as well as roof service. Being thorough in regular inspection is important for the structural integrity of your entire home.
